云服务器是怎么搞的呀,揭秘云服务器,构建虚拟世界的幕后黑手
- 综合资讯
- 2024-10-31 18:43:07
- 2

云服务器通过虚拟化技术,将物理服务器资源转化为可分配的虚拟资源,构建虚拟世界。它是构建云计算平台的核心,实现数据存储、计算和应用的远程访问,成为幕后黑手,推动着互联网的...
云服务器通过虚拟化技术,将物理服务器资源转化为可分配的虚拟资源,构建虚拟世界。它是构建云计算平台的核心,实现数据存储、计算和应用的远程访问,成为幕后黑手,推动着互联网的快速发展。
随着互联网技术的飞速发展,云计算已成为当今科技领域的一大热门,云服务器作为云计算的核心组成部分,扮演着至关重要的角色,云服务器是如何构建的?本文将带您揭开云服务器的神秘面纱。
云服务器的概念
云服务器,顾名思义,是一种基于云计算技术的服务器,它将物理服务器虚拟化,通过虚拟化技术将一台物理服务器划分为多个虚拟服务器,从而实现资源的灵活分配和高效利用。
云服务器的构建原理
1、虚拟化技术
虚拟化技术是云服务器构建的核心,它通过在物理服务器上安装虚拟化软件,将物理资源抽象为虚拟资源,实现资源的隔离、管理和扩展。
(1)硬件虚拟化:通过CPU虚拟化、内存虚拟化、存储虚拟化等技术,将物理硬件资源转化为虚拟资源。
(2)操作系统虚拟化:通过虚拟机管理程序(VMM),将物理服务器的操作系统转化为多个虚拟操作系统,实现虚拟机的创建、管理和扩展。
2、资源池化
资源池化是将物理服务器上的资源进行整合,形成一个统一的资源池,资源池化包括计算资源、存储资源和网络资源。
(1)计算资源池:将物理服务器的CPU、内存等计算资源整合成一个计算资源池,实现虚拟机的动态分配和扩展。
(2)存储资源池:将物理服务器的硬盘、SSD等存储资源整合成一个存储资源池,实现数据的集中存储和高效访问。
(3)网络资源池:将物理服务器的网络接口、IP地址等网络资源整合成一个网络资源池,实现虚拟机的网络连接和通信。
3、分布式存储
分布式存储是将数据存储在多个物理服务器上,通过分布式文件系统(DFS)等技术实现数据的分布式存储、备份和恢复。
(1)数据冗余:通过数据冗余技术,如RAID(独立磁盘冗余阵列),提高数据的可靠性和安全性。
(2)负载均衡:通过负载均衡技术,如LVS(Linux虚拟服务器),实现数据的均衡分配和高效访问。
4、自动化运维
自动化运维是云服务器构建的重要环节,通过自动化运维工具,实现对虚拟机的自动化部署、监控、备份和恢复。
(1)自动化部署:通过自动化部署工具,如Ansible、Chef等,实现虚拟机的快速部署和配置。
(2)监控:通过监控工具,如Nagios、Zabbix等,实现对虚拟机的实时监控和性能分析。
(3)备份与恢复:通过备份与恢复工具,如Veeam、Acronis等,实现虚拟机的数据备份和恢复。
云服务器的优势
1、高效资源利用:通过虚拟化技术,实现资源的灵活分配和高效利用,降低企业IT成本。
2、弹性伸缩:根据业务需求,实现虚拟机的动态分配和扩展,提高业务系统的稳定性和可靠性。
3、高可用性:通过分布式存储和备份恢复技术,提高数据的安全性和可靠性。
4、灵活部署:支持多种虚拟化技术,满足不同业务场景的需求。
云服务器作为云计算的核心组成部分,已成为当今企业IT建设的重要选择,通过虚拟化、资源池化、分布式存储和自动化运维等技术,云服务器为用户提供了高效、稳定、可靠的IT服务,随着云计算技术的不断发展,云服务器将在未来发挥更加重要的作用。
本文链接:https://www.zhitaoyun.cn/467266.html
发表评论